Find a respectable shop... The install isn't the hard part, the instructions are fairly easy to follow as long as you have a Ford manual to find all of the wires on the 'tour. The hard part is in the tuning, which will be individual for every car and must be done on the dyno because the car's sensors are not "wide band" enough to be able to set this thing up without risking engine damage. Using someone else's setting should only be a starting point from which to dyno tune to be correct for your car.
